CFodder 02-17-2009 06:04 AM

Have fixed my prob with the no response, it was my webhost blocking the vent server port, got them to whitelist it for outgoing queries and it's all working perfect now ... Thanks for all your help too Crimm, good to see people supporting their mods :).
